Event Description:

This event is for Oakland County Public School Employees only.

This is a foundational learning opportunity for those working with students who have complex communication needs, requiring Augmentative/Alternative Communication (AAC). The focus is building shared knowledge in AAC and language.The topics will include: Communication Mindset, Core Vocabulary, Aided Language Input, Vocabulary Instruction and Communication Opportunities.
